Overview of Electroplating Nail Machines

Electroplating nail machines are essential tools in the manufacturing process of high-quality nails. These machines utilize the electroplating technique to coat nails with a metallic layer, enhancing their durability and aesthetic appeal. The process involves depositing a thin layer of metal onto the surface of the nails through an electrolytic solution, which not only improves corrosion resistance but also provides a shiny finish.

The machines are designed for efficiency and precision, allowing manufacturers to produce large quantities of nails with consistent quality. With advancements in technology, modern electroplating machines can adjust parameters such as voltage and current in real-time, ensuring optimal coating thickness and uniformity across all products.

Key Features of Electroplating Nail Machines

One of the standout features of electroplating nail machines is their automation capabilities. Many models come equipped with programmable logic controllers (PLCs) that facilitate automatic operation, reducing the need for manual intervention and minimizing human error. This automation not only speeds up production but also enhances safety in the workplace.

Additionally, these machines often include advanced monitoring systems that track the electroplating process. This feature allows operators to ensure that the machine is functioning correctly and that the coating process meets quality standards. By utilizing sensors and feedback loops, manufacturers can achieve greater control over the electroplating process.

Benefits of Using Electroplating Nail Machines

The use of electroplating nail machines offers numerous benefits to manufacturers in the metalworking industry. Firstly, they provide significant cost savings by reducing material waste and increasing production efficiency. By applying a precise amount of metal coating, manufacturers can minimize excess usage, thus lowering overall expenses.

Furthermore, electroplated nails exhibit superior performance characteristics compared to non-coated alternatives. The enhanced strength and corrosion resistance of electroplated nails make them suitable for various applications, including construction and automotive industries.
